Kenosha School District vs Poynette School District

How do these districts compare?

Metric Kenosha School District Poynette School District
Location Kenosha, Wisconsin Poynette, Wisconsin
Total Enrollment 19,069 1,001
Number of Schools 43 3
Student:Teacher Ratio 14.5:1 12.3:1

Spending

Metric Kenosha School District Poynette School District
Per-Pupil Expenditure $15,612 $15,932
Federal Revenue 13.7% 7.6%
State Revenue 56.2% 40.6%
Local Revenue 30.1% 51.7%

Demographics

Average across all schools in each district. Source: CCD Membership 2024-25.

Group Kenosha School District Poynette School District
White 43.5% 91.5%
African American 14.6% 0.8%
Hispanic or Latino 32.1% 3.6%
Asian 1.4% 0.8%
American Indian / Alaska Native 0.2% 0.7%
Pacific Islander 0.1% 0.0%
Multiracial 8.1% 2.7%
Free/Reduced Lunch 55.7% 21.8%
